Embrace this pivotal role in patient care as you work alongside the Registered Nurse. You’ll support direct patient care, prepare the Operating Room pre‑ and post‑surgery, arrange sterile instruments, and maintain aseptic techniques. Key responsibilities of a Surgical Technologist include, but are not limited to:
- Ensure top‑notch patient care, safety, and advocacy by anticipating and addressing case‑specific needs with sharp critical thinking under RN supervision.
- Uphold excellence by impeccably managing instruments, equipment, and supplies, ensuring timeliness and accuracy.
